Through Center for Diagnostic Imaging`s national network, including Insight Imaging, we partner with healthcare providers to do what we do best — manage and deliver high-quality medical imaging (i.e. MRI, PET/CT, etc.) and related services (i.e. injections for pain) to enhance patient care. CDI offers the highest quality of care through a network of outpatient imaging centers and mobile facilities in more than thirty states. Head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ota; the organization serves more than one million patients a year through a diverse set of customers including healthcare providers, managed care organizations, hospitals, health systems and payors (government and third party). Our local providers and partners are connected through CDI`s large network to other clinical providers and staff across the country. Through CDI`s sophisticated network, our partners access best practices and have the ability to consult with other specialized physicians, when needed, to improve patient care and outcomes.
